

BONE QUALITY – THE KEY TO SUCCESS IN IMPLANTOLOGY
The application of modern technological procedures and materials in the production of dental implants and the definition of implant placing and loading protocols have made implant therapy significantly more successful and predictable. The factor that has probably the most significant role in the success of the implantation is the bone as the acceptor of the implant. Procedures that can influence the quantity and quality of bone tissue in the area of planned implant placement are limited. Therefore, it is of crucial importance, in pre-implantation planning, to analyze the quantity and quality of bone tissue (bone density and distribution of spongiosa and compacta) and choose the optimal dimension and design of the implant, the implant placement protocol, any additional surgical procedures and the implant loading protocol. Such analyzes are facilitated in modern implantology by the use of CBCT softwares, which day by day provide us with more and more possibilities. In the lecture, the possibilities of bone tissue density analysis and pre-implantation planning in the CBCT software will be presented, as well as studies in which these procedures were used.
Prof. dr Zoran Vlahovic, DMD, Phd, oral surgeon
Academic and professional career
Graduated at the Faculty of Medicine, Branch if Dentistry, Pristna / 1997.
Internship / 1997. – 1998.
Military Airport Podgorica / 1998. - 2006.
Training Programme in Oral Surgery / 2007. – 2010.
Doctoral studies / 2010. - 2013.
Branch of Dentistry, Medical Faculty Pristina - Kos. Mitrovica
Ass. prof. Oral Surgery and Oral implantology / 2013. - 2018.
Assoc. prof. Oral Surgery and Oral implantology / 2018. - 2023.
Full prof. Oral Surgery and Oral implantology / 2023. -
Scientific research
More than 30 lectures and 40 papers (journals, congresses, symposium). 21 on the SCI list
Author of “Oral Implantology Practicum” and “CBCT in dentistry” textbook
Member of Association of Oral Surgeons and Association of Oral Implantologist Ser-bia, Member of Editoral board Balkan Journal of Dental Medicine
Vice president of Balkan Stomatological Society (BaSS)
Planmeca (Finland) lecturer in field of CBCT radiology
Visiting profesor in International Balkan University in Skopje, North Macedonia and Medical Faculty Foča in Bosnia and Herzegovina
